$330,000 worth of RTX 3090 GPUs have been stolen from an MSI factory – TechRadar
An inside job?

Thieves appear to be trying to cash in on the current shortage of nex-gen graphics cards, as it’s been reported that around 220 Nvidia GeForce RTX 3090s have been stolen from an MSI factory in China.
The haul is estimated to have a retail value of $330,000 (around £255,000 or AU$460,000). MSI has notified the police, and announced a reward of 100,000 Yuan (about $15,000) for anyone who has useful information regarding the theft, which happened on December 7, or the whereabouts of the missing cards.
